			Automatic Equipment Identifier - 




fjrigjwwe9r0logisticsglossary:definition
A transponder built into a container which transmits information about the container such as weight and container number for automatic update to a shipping database. Acronym: AEI

Container (1) -

fjrigjwwe9r0logisticsglossary:definition
Standard-sized rectangular box used to transport freight by ship, rail and highway. International shipping containers are 20 or 40 feet long, conform to International Standards Organization (ISO) standards and are designed to fit in ships' holds. Containers are transported on public roads atop a container chassis towed by a Reference: Truck Writers of North America (TWNA)

Drayage -

fjrigjwwe9r0logisticsglossary:definition
A service offered by a motor carrier for the cartage of rail or ocean containers from a dock to an intermediate or final destination, or the charge for such cartage.

Less Than Truckload -

fjrigjwwe9r0logisticsglossary:definition
A shipment in which the freight does not completely fill the trailer or container; or a particular consignor's freight when combined with others to produce a full truckload or full container load. Acronym: LTL Reference: less than container load,

Twenty-Foot Equivalent Unit -

fjrigjwwe9r0logisticsglossary:definition
Standardized unit for measuring container capacity on ships, railcars, etc. Acronym: TEU Reference: Truck Writers of North America (TWNA)
